By Tube (London Underground)

The London Underground, affectionately known as the Tube, is a convenient and efficient way to reach Excel London. The DLR (Docklands Light Railway) is your direct route, with frequent services running from central London. Here’s how to get there:

  • From Central London: Take the Jubilee line to Canary Wharf, then switch to the DLR and travel towards Beckton. Get off at the “Royal Albert” station, which is directly connected to Excel London.
  • From other parts of London: You can also use other Tube lines like the Northern, Victoria, or Bakerloo lines to reach Canary Wharf and then switch to the DLR.

By Bus

London’s extensive bus network provides a cost-effective way to reach Excel London.

  • Direct Bus Routes: Several bus routes operate directly to Excel London, including the 108, 104, 262, and 473. Check the Transport for London (TfL) website for the latest bus schedules and routes.
  • Bus Transfers: You can also take a bus to Canary Wharf and then switch to the DLR to reach Excel London.

A Word About Accessibility

Excel London is committed to providing accessible facilities for all visitors. There are dedicated lifts, ramps, and accessible restrooms throughout the venue. You can find detailed information about accessibility on the Excel London website.
